Summary
Key Facts
- Lobbyist Pedro Cervantes was retained by Riot Fest Corporation.
- The lobbying activity targeted the Chicago Park District.
- The stated goal of the lobbying was to obtain a permit for a festival.
- The lobbying activity covered the period from July 1, 2015, to September 30, 2015.
- The scope of lobbying included both administrative and legislative actions.
